Emotional Freedom Techniques or EFT, simply stated, is emotional or psychological acupressure. Acupressure is the act of applying manual pressure, or tapping, usually with the fingertips, on various meridians located on the surface of the body, the same meridians used in acupuncture. Meridians are the channels through which energy flows, much the same as veins and capillaries are the channels through which blood flows. Energy needs to flow freely and unimpeded through these channels, otherwise it stagnates and becomes blocked, this congested and clogged energy can eventually become so dense that it results in emotional and physical dis-ease. EFT helps to dissolve and release the energetic blocks and restores the natural flow to our Life Energy.
